Health care
The African grey parrot is a beloved bird that requires a special attention. They are among the most intelligent birds that live in the avian world and are vocal. They are also renowned for their amazing mimicking abilities.
If they are properly cared for the birds will live a very long time. The first year of ownership could be expensive for the first-time owners. This is due to the fact that there are many one-time expenses that can add up. This includes a large cage and supplies such as water and food bowls. You must also take your bird to a veterinarian that is specialized in exotic animals for a check-up every year.
african grey parrots On sale (http://222.239.231.61/) grey parrots require cages that is at least two feet tall and three feet wide. They should be provided with daily meals of half a cup pellet mix and a quarter cup of fruits and vegetables. They should also spend at minimum one hour of playtime with their pet owners every day. These can include games, puzzles and lessons. To build muscle and prevent obesity, they should also have time each day out of their cages.

Feeding
These birds are smart and require lots of interaction with their owners. These birds have been known to build bonds of trust with a single person. This is why they are very popular as pets, however when they aren't properly taken care of or are not suitable for a family environment, they will often exhibit self-destructive behavior, such as feather plucking and screaming. It is important to ensure you are ready for the commitment that comes with purchasing a parrot. If you're not, then a rescue center is the ideal option. These organizations can assist you in selecting a parrot that is compatible with your lifestyle and circumstances.
Parrots require mental stimulation in order to keep them from becoming bored and aggressive. Every day, they should have at least an hour of stimulating time with their pet. This should include games, puzzles, and lessons. They also require a top quality cage with plenty of bars to perch on and other activities. They should be offered an assortment of fresh fruits, vegetables and a small amount of seed every day. If they are not fed the right amount of nutrients, they may become ill.
It is always a good idea to consult a qualified avian veterinarian for advice if you're not sure what diet to feed your grey bird. A vet will be able to determine if you're feeding your bird the proper proportion of proteins, carbs and fats. They will also be able to tell you whether your bird is receiving enough minerals and vitamins.
One of the most common mistakes that new grey owners make is not cleaning out the food that is not eaten every day from their cages. This can cause various health issues in your pet, such as weight growth and nutritional deficiencies. They could also experience gastrointestinal issues such as constipation and diarrhea.
If you plan on bringing home an African Grey, it's important to have the right housing and equipment for your bird. You will need to have an enormous cage that has enough space between the bars to ensure that your bird doesn't be trapped in its head. Also, you should have various toys and chewable materials for your parrot. You should talk to a dealer or someone familiar with parrots before buying a cage. They can give you the ideal cage to meet your needs.
Training
Gizmo newborn african grey parrot Greys are among the most intelligent parrots. They can mimic sounds, whistles and even speak words. They often bond to one particular family member and miss them when they are absent. As a result, they require regular human interaction and lengthy periods of time outside of their cage in order to flourish. This includes daily enrichment with their owner. This includes puzzles, games, and even lessons.
A lonely African Grey will get bored and unhappy quickly. It may start to scream, feather pick and bite in an effort to communicate its emotions and desires. The bird could also develop several health issues, including calcium deficiency, vitamin-A and deficiency in vitamin D.
It is best to give your African Grey plenty of mental and/or physical stimulation in order to avoid problems. This can be achieved through regular and varied enrichment activities like playing with toys and games, and by training the bird to speak in a way that you can understand. It is advised to avoid using the term "obedience" in training your pet, since this implies dominance and may create stress for your bird.

It is essential to look for a reputable breeder when looking for an African gray parrot for sale. Breeders who are trustworthy will place the health and welfare of their birds over profits. They will also be able to answer any questions you have about their breeding practices and the background of the bird. They will also have detailed knowledge about the requirements of this species and will be able to suggest the ideal type of home for your new pet.
Additionally, you should determine whether the breeder has any previous experience with african greys or not. Additionally, it is crucial to inquire about the breeder's socialization and handling practices. It is important to ensure that the birds are socialized and comfortable around humans, as this will assist them in adjusting to their human family members quickly.
